英文摘要
The corrosion problem of steel reinforcing bars is the greatest factor in limiting the life expectancy of reinforced concrete (RC) structures. In some cases, the repair cost can be twice as high as the initial cost. A well-recognized solution to overcome problems related to steel corrosion is the use of the non-corrodible Fibre-Reinforced Polymer (FRP) bars in RC structures. In the last two decades, extensive research efforts along with the advancement in manufacturing processes and numerous successful field applications have led to the development of FRP design standards. However, these standards are missing design procedures and guidelines for structural members in seismic zones due to a lack of research data in this area, which limits the wide spread of FRP technology. A prime example of these structural elements is RC columns. It is well-documented that the inadequate seismic resistance of columns is the most likely cause for the collapse of many RC structures and bridges in major earthquakes, leading to great loss of life and assets. In addition to the necessity of performing seismic analysis of buildings, as required by the Canadian national building code, the use of linear-elastic FRP materials in seismic regions could be advantageous due to the small residual deformations that occur in FRP-RC structures following large drifts, which result in reduced need for rehabilitation. The applicant's research program focusses on better understanding the behaviour and use of FRP reinforcement in different structural applications by developing complete and inclusive design provisions for FRP-RC structures under different loading and environmental conditions. The proposed research will provide this much needed data and introduce design procedures through conducting experimental and analytical investigations on the structural performance of FRP-RC columns under seismic-simulated loads. The experimental work will be conducted on full-scale columns representing the most critical part of a column above foundation. The analytical part will include the development of concrete confinement and bond-slip models for FRP-RC columns that will be further incorporated into a nonlinear finite element software to run an extensive parametric study.
